DEVICE AND METHOD FOR APPLYING SUBSTANCES TO A BODY
REFERENCE TO PENDING APPLICATIONS
[0001] This application does not claim the benefit of pending application.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
1. Field of the Invention
[0002] The present disclosure relates to a device and method for self-
application of
substances to a body, particularly to a device having an applicator pad and a
manipulation
member to facilitate the application of substances to difficult-to-reach
areas.
2. Description of the Related Art
[0003] Applying formulations; including lotions, creams, ointments, oils,
sunscreens, sun tan
lotions, sun blocks, insect repellents, or medications to various parts of the
body is often
necessary when skin becomes dry, irritated, rough or abraded due to exposure
to harmful
conditions, or to protect skin from insects or damaging exposure to sunlight.
[0004] The application of such formulations, however, to difficult-to-reach
areas of the body
is a challenge to many people, especially the elderly or people with reduced
mobility due to a
medical condition, infirmity or lack of flexibility. Areas which present most
difficulty are
typically the back, shoulders, legs and feet.
[0005] Devices for applying such formulations to difficult-to-reach areas have
been described
in the prior art. For example: US6851154 describes a device having a washable
applicator
member having a defined thickness comprising a first layer of material and a
second layer of
material which is, at least in part, non-absorbent and preferably water
repellent material. The
second layer of the applicator member is also structured with an absorbent
layer providing a

[0034] The present invention describes a device and method for self-
application of
substances, including but not limited to lotions, creams, ointments, suntan
lotions, sunscreens
and sun blocks, oils, insect repellents, medicaments and the like. It features
a non-absorbent
applicator attached to one or more manipulation members. It allows for the
application of
substances to difficult-to-reach areas of the body, such as but not limited
to, the back,
shoulders, legs and feet. It is convenient, affordable, compact, portable and
easy to use for
adults, children, the elderly and by people with limited mobility.
[0035] The non-absorbent applicator reduces waste as it will not absorb
substances, but it is
durable, wipes clean and is washable. The method of using the device is
simple; the
substance to be applied to the body is loaded onto the applicator. Loading is
typically
achieved by pouring, spraying or spreading. The applicator is placed over the
area on the
body to be treated; the opposing ends of the manipulation members are held and
pulled back
and forth and up and down across the area of the body to be treated, thereby
applying the
substance to the difficult-to-reach area.

[0042] Referring now to FIGS. 4-5, which illustrate a top perspective view of
the first surface
104 and the second surface 106 of the device 100 according to an embodiment of
the present
invention. FIGS. 4-5 illustrate different textures of the surface of the
applicator member 102
that can be used in different embodiments of the invention. In one embodiment
of the
invention the applicator member 102 can be manufactured having different
textures on either
side. For example, FIG 4 shows a ridged first surface 304 and shows a smoother
second
surface 106. Substances having lower viscosity, such as oils and lotions,
typically adhere to a
first surface 104 having ridges or pimples, whereas FIG. 5 a smoother second
surface 106 can
be used to apply substances having higher viscosity, such as creams or
ointments.
